Using web publish as customer portal using Tokens?

Hi,

 

I was wondering if its possible to use #tokens with the publish to web.

 

My thought where to generate tokens to customers and then based on the the tokens show specific customer data through the powerbi publish to web dashboards.

 

Is this acheivable?

@Anonymous

"Publish to web" is as literally. Every one would see the same data. So the simple answer to your question is NO.

 

As to #token, I suppose you're talking about embedding a report. In both way, Power BI Embedded and Embed via REST API, RLS can be implemented.

 

Check 

Row level security with Power BI Embedded

 

While Embed via REST API, RLS works the same way in as Row-level security (RLS) with Power BI.

Hi Eric,

 

I was meaning as a #variable so for example we could pass a customer id as a #variable in the url?

 

Thanks

Chris

@Anonymous

You can try to append the customid column to the url, check 

http://stackoverflow.com/questions/35555694/passing-parameters-to-power-bi-filter-programmatically

 

But everyone has the url can remove the filter, so it won't as a security feature.
